Get ready to tease your taste buds with this easy drink recipe for a cucumber gimlet compliments of Ocean Prime Restaurant.

Ingredients
- 1 ½ oz. Bombay Sapphire Gin
- 1 oz. freshly squeezed lime juice
- 1 oz. simple syrup
- 4 to 5 lices of cucumber
Instructions
- Fill glass with ice
- Add cucumber, fresh lime and simple syrup to a mixing tin
- Muddle with three ice cubes until the cucumber is dissolved
- Add ice to the mixing tin to fill it halfway
- Shake gently and strain into iced glass and enjoy!
Notes
- Definitely shake, don't stir this one! It really combines those flavors.
